Walking Miracle: Mindset That Overcame Paralysis w/ Ryan Shazier

Ryan Shazier, a former NFL linebacker for the Pittsburgh Steelers, shares his incredible journey from a life-changing spinal injury to walking again. He opens up about the emotional rollercoaster he faced post-injury, the challenges of recovery, and the power of a positive mindset. Ryan emphasizes the importance of belief and support from loved ones in overcoming adversity. His story highlights the struggle of redefining identity beyond athletic achievements and discovering a new purpose in life, stirring inspiration for anyone facing challenges.

Unlocking Secrets to Business Growth w/ Alex Hormozi

In this engaging discussion, Alex Hormozi, a serial entrepreneur and CEO of Acquisition.com, shares invaluable insights on scaling businesses for long-term success. He emphasizes the importance of leverage, detailing its four types: labor, capital, software, and media. Alex discusses the concept of operating with urgency and introduces his Everyday Urgency Blueprint, which can transform personal and business growth. He also delves into balancing ambition with gratitude, resilience in the face of challenges, and the emotional dynamics that drive profitability.
